To Add to 93Corvette's responses:

1. For Prior Service, the Navy Reserve offers Sailors the chance to complete IS "A" Res, which is the equivalent of IS "A" School (in Dam Neck, VA). IS "A" Res is conducted on approx. 7 drill weekends (JAX, ATL, and other sites around the US) and completed with a 2-week AT at the Navy & Marine Corps Intelligence Training Center (NMITC) in Dam Neck, VA.

2. Deployment/Mobilization

It varies. Many Reserve IS's have already deployed and they will likely continue to support operations in OEF/OIF. This would become most likely after completing "C" School.

4-5. "C" Schools are advanced training and you receive an Navy Enlisted Classification (NEC) upon completion; it is similar to the Army's skill identifiers that they add to MOS's. The unit your are assigned to, combined with the needs of the Navy, will dictate which "C" School you attend. "C" Schools are held at NMITC -- do a search on this forum for the specific NEC's available -- I've already posted the information in the past. The only exception to going to NMITC, is some intel training sites conduct Operational Intel (NEC 3924) training on drill weekends.

If I read this correctly you are going in as an IS in the Reserves. What he is talking about is not A school. It use to be called NBIT but they changed the name a little while ago and now if you join NPS you go to the full boot camp and full A school. The new school is every drill weekend, and you will go over the basics of Intel, this is local to your NIRR. You will then do your 2 weeks at Dam Neck, learning more Intel stuff.

In today's Reserves you need to plan on being deployed. I would bet that you will be near the top of the MOB list in your area considering the rank you will be coming in with. I am not sure on this, but I don't think you have to have completed C school to be deployed.
